Half of Jamaica’s inhabitants reeling from Hurricane Melissa

Greater than 130 roads had been blocked, energy and communication networks disrupted, whereas well being companies stay beneath heavy pressure, in response to the UN support coordination workplace (OCHA). 

“As much as 360,000 individuals might require meals help”, underscored the World Meals Programme (WFP). Entry to some western parishes proceed to be tough as a consequence of particles and gasoline shortages, OCHA mentioned.

WFP has been “working across the clock”, creating joint plans and methods with the Authorities, mentioned Brian Bogart, Nation Director for WFP Multi-Nation Caribbean Workplace, briefing journalists in New York by way of video hyperlink.

Jamaican resilience

“The Jamaican persons are resilient”, he mentioned, “however they want pressing assist to keep up that resilience. 

Mr. Bogart reiterated that pressing wants stay meals, water, shelter, and medication for communities which have been hardest hit.

Prior to now two days, each a French and a Dutch navy vessel loaded with reduction objects have made landfall in Kingston’s harbour. 

Within the days forward, WFP is planning to help as much as 200,000 individuals throughout the nation with meals help and money transfers, which is crucial because the nation strikes from an instantaneous humanitarian response to a longer-term restoration technique. 

Cuba and Haiti

Meals distribution in Cuba has already reached 180,000 in safety centres throughout the provinces of Granma, Santiago de Cuba, and Guantanamo, reported WFP Nation Director there, Etienne Labande. 

Highlighting the UN meals businesses’ deep understanding of the native context and their potential to coordinate with authorities and communities, M. Labande emphasised that having WFP on the bottom was “crucial” for making certain a quick and efficient response.

In the meantime, in Haiti, a minimum of 30 individuals died through the excessive climate generated by Melissa, in response to the authorities.

“An estimated 1.25 million individuals have been affected by the hurricane”, mentioned the Cuba nation director. 

To make issues worse, reduction efforts and the supply of ongoing support are additional sophisticated by the persevering with humanitarian disaster and safety vacuum created by armed teams who management the overwhelming majority of the capital, Port au Prince.

“Restoration is a marathon, not a dash”, underscored M Labande. 

Regardless of extreme funding shortages, entry challenges and logistical constraints, the UN and companions are persevering with to evaluate injury and ramping up efforts to succeed in individuals in want.

$74 million is urgently wanted to ship life-saving help to as much as 1.1 million individuals throughout the Caribbean within the wake of Melissa, and coordinate emergency logistics and telecommunications.
